mlabel(1)mlabel(1)NAMEmlabel - mtools utility to label a DOS volume
SYNOPSISmlabel [-v] drive:

DESCRIPTION
The mlabel command displays the current volume label, if present, and
prompts the user for a new volume label. To delete an existing volume
label, press the Return Key at the prompt.
Reasonable care is taken to create a valid DOS volume label. If an
invalid label is specified, the mlabel command changes the label and
displays the new label if the -v option is specified.
